A股上市公司传智教育(股票代码 003032)旗下技术交流社区北京昌平校区

 找回密码
 加入黑马

QQ登录

只需一步,快速开始

【郑州校区】品优购电商系统部署 Day 1 十

3.2.4 启动集群
1)启动每个 tomcat 实例。要保证 zookeeper 集群是启动状态。
---- 知识点小贴士 -----
如果你想让某个文件夹下都可以执行,使用以下命令实现
chmod -R 777 solr-cloud

2)访问集群
地址栏输入 http://192.168.25.140:8180/solr ,可以看到 Solr 集群版的界面


下图表示的是,一个主节点 ,三个从节点。


3.3 SpringDataSolr 连接 SolrCloud
SolrJ 中提供一个叫做 CloudSolrServer 的类,它是 SolrServer 的子类,用于连接 solrCloud它的构造参数就是 zookeeper 的地址列表,另外它要求要指定 defaultCollection 属性(默认collection 名称)
我们现在修改 springDataSolrDemo 工程的配置文件 ,把原来的 solr-server 注销,替换为CloudSolrServer .指定构造参数为地址列表,设置默认 collection 名称

[AppleScript] 纯文本查看 复制代码
<!-- solr 服务器地址
<solr:solr-server id="solrServer" url="http://192.168.25.129:8080/solr" />
-->
<bean id="solrServer" class="org.apache.solr.client.solrj.impl.CloudSolrServer">
<constructor-arg
value="192.168.25.140:2181,192.168.25.140:2182,192.168.25.140:2183" />
<property name="defaultCollection" value="collection1"></property>
</bean>


0 个回复

您需要登录后才可以回帖 登录 | 加入黑马